About
The classic board game comes to life (no pun intended) on the PC and PlayStation. This is the 1998 Mass Media, Inc. version, and features Full Motion Videos on Enhanced version. Play the Classic or Enhanced version of the classic game. Spin the spinner, get a job, get married, buy a house, play the stock market, take revenge against other players and gain wealth. Play up to 6 players either over a network or the internet.
